Ingredients
To make this scrumptious Beef Broccoli Stir Fry, you’ll need the following ingredients:
- 1 tablespoon cornstarch
- ½ cup water
- ¼ cup low sodium soy sauce
- 2 tablespoons light brown sugar
- 1 teaspoon fresh ginger, grated
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- ¼ teaspoon red pepper flakes
- 1 pound fresh broccoli, cut into bite-size pieces
- 1 pound flank steak, sliced thin against the grain
- 2 tablespoons olive oil, divided
- 1 tablespoon sesame seeds for garnish

How to Make the Recipe
Let’s get cooking! Follow these simple steps to create your Teriyaki Glaze and stir-fry:
- In a small mixing bowl, dissolve 1 tablespoon cornstarch in ½ cup water until completely smooth.
- Stir in the soy sauce, brown sugar, grated ginger, minced garlic, and red pepper flakes. Set aside.
- Cut the broccoli head into uniform bite-size pieces for even cooking.
- Slice the flank steak thinly (about ¼-inch thick) against the grain for tenderness.
-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add the broccoli, then 2 tablespoons of water. Cover and steam briefly.
- Remove the lid and continue cooking until the water absorbs and the broccoli is crisp-tender. Transfer to a plate.
- Add the remaining oil to the pan, increase to high heat, and add the beef in a single layer. Cook until browned.
- Reduce heat to medium-low, add the sauce mixture, and cook until bubbling and thickened.
- Return the broccoli to the pan, toss to combine, and sprinkle with sesame seeds. Serve over rice or noodles!
Pro Tips for Making the Recipe
Here are some of my favorite tips to ensure your stir-fry turns out perfectly:
- Make sure to slice the flank steak against the grain for maximum tenderness.
- Don’t overcrowd the pan when cooking the beef; this helps it brown nicely.
- Feel free to add other vegetables like bell peppers or snap peas for extra color and nutrition.
- If you prefer a spicier kick, increase the amount of red pepper flakes or add a splash of sriracha.
- For a gluten-free option, use tamari instead of soy sauce and serve with Gluten Free Rice.

Make Ahead and Storage
This stir-fry is perfect for meal prep! Here’s how to store it:
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
- Reheat in the microwave or on the stovetop until heated through.
- For meal prep bowls, divide the stir-fry into individual containers with rice or noodles for easy grab-and-go lunches!
